Rumah > Soal Jawab > teks badan
Ia sangat mudah, saya hanya meletakkan kod kunci
<p ng-controller="myCtrl">
<input type="text" ng-model="clock.now"></p>
function myCtrl($scope,$timeout){
$scope.clock = {
now : new Date()
}
var updateClock = function(){
$scope.clock.now = new Date() ;
}
//$timeout(function(){
setInterval(function(){
updateClock()
$scope.$apply()
},1000)
updateClock();
}
Anda boleh menggunakan setInterval, tetapi bukan $timeout Mengapa?
ringa_lee2017-05-15 16:51:56
Nah, $timeout
dan setInterval
bukan sepasang Anda perlu menggunakan $interval
jika anda ingin menggunakannya...; $timeout
ialah enkapsulasi setTimeout
.